Dr. Roohi Jeelani

Dr. Roohi Jeelani, MD, FACOG is a double board-certified Reproductive Endocrinologist and Infertility Specialist. She completed her fellowship in Reproductive Endocrinology at Wayne State University and has authored numerous publications on fertility, toxins, and reproductive health. Her clinical interests include oncofertility, hormonal disruption, and fertility preservation.

The Environmental Working Group

EWG empowers parents to make safer and healthier decisions by publishing research on avoiding the impact of toxic chemicals and choosing safer products for our families.

Saving Mothers

A global nonprofit organization of allied healthcare professionals dedicated to eradicating preventable maternal deaths and birth related complications among marginalized women.

Black Mamas Matter Alliance

(BMMA) is a Black women-led cross-sectoral alliance that centers Black mamas and birthing people to advocate, drive research, build power, and shift culture for Black maternal health, rights, and justice.

Moms 4 moms nyc

A 501(c)3 non-profit dedicated to providing assistance to single mothers in need through the monthly distribution of its signature Postpartum Recovery Kits and Newborn Baby Bundles.
